South Dakota Weather Map: Understanding the Seasons South Dakota experiences four distinct seasons, each with its own unique characteristics. Spring (March-May) brings mild temperatures and occasional showers, but can also see snowstorms and tornadoes. Summer (June-August) is warm to hot and humid, with frequent thunderstorms and the potential for hail. Fall (September-November) is mild and pleasant, with cooler temperatures and changing foliage. Winter (December-February) is cold and snowy, with occasional blizzards and subzero temperatures. As you plan your trip, it's important to consider the weather patterns and pack accordingly. For summer trips, be prepared for warm temperatures and sudden thunderstorms. Winter trips require warm layers and sturdy boots for trudging through snow. Spring and fall offer milder weather, but still require a range of clothing options to stay comfortable. Local Culture: Exploring South Dakota's Heritage South Dakota has a rich cultural heritage, with strong ties to Native American traditions and cowboy culture. The Lakota Sioux and other tribes have a deep history in the state, with many reservations offering powwows and cultural experiences for visitors. Deadwood, a historic mining town, offers a glimpse into the Wild West era with its preserved buildings and reenactments. Food is also an important part of South Dakota's culture, with many local specialties to try. Native American cuisine includes dishes like fry bread and buffalo stew, while cowboy culture brings hearty meals like steak and potatoes.
